Awards

  • In 2006, received Los Angeles Film Critics Association Award for Best Supporting Actor
  • In 2006, received Toronto Film Critics Association Award for Best Supporting Performance, Male

Highlights

  • In 2009, Reprised role of Lucian for "Underworld: Rise of the Lycans"
  • In 2008, Reprised the role of David Frost for Peter Morgan's film adaption of "Frost/Nixon"
  • In 2007, Portrayed David Frost on Broadway in Peter Morgan's acclaimed drama "Frost/Nixon"

Family & Companions

  • Kate Beckinsale: met when they acted together on stage in "The Seagull" (1995); no longer together as of January 2003
  • Meyrick Sheen: father (Successful part-time professional Jack Nicholson look-alike)
